Description

VMSalgaocar Medical Research Centre was established in 1978 at Chicalim Goa as part of our commitment to provide better health care in Goa The Centre now runs the ultramodern multispecialty tertiary care VM Salgaocar Hospital with 120 beds including 26 for critical care The Hospital offers comprehensive medical services from clinical investigations to surgery and postoperative care with stateoftheart equipment An Out Patient Department a DayCare Centre and an exclusive Centre for Health Checks make it unique It includes the VIVUS SMRC Heart Centre dedicated to complete cardiac care covering invasive noninvasive diagnostic and cardiac surgery

A team of highly qualified medical professionals paramedical staff and managerial support executives offer round the clock dedicated services All disciplines and departments regularly update their knowledge and skills in clinical and research studies to ensure international standards in healthcare
